Morgan Stanley, CIT Group are among big movers

<div><p>Stocks that moved substantially or traded heavily Wednesday on the New York Stock Exchange:</p><p>NYSE</p><p>Morgan Stanley, up 37 cents at $16.50</p><p>The banking firm posted a quarterly loss of $2.37 billion, or $2.34 per share, but its stock rebounded after early losses.</p><p>CIT Group Inc., down 17 cents at $4.48</p><p>The finance company said it would raise $250 million through a stock offering as it seeks to tap federal rescue funds.</p><p>General Mills Inc., up 10 cents at $61.35</p><p>The cereal maker said quarterly profit slipped 3 percent, but adjusted results beat expectations on lower costs.</p><p>Constellation Energy Group Inc., down $5.74 at $23</p><p>The energy company will sell half its nuclear power business to French state-controlled power company EdF for $4.5 billion.</p><p>Newell Rubbermaid Inc., down $3.60 at $9.58</p><p>The Sharpie maker slashed fourth-quarter and full-year profit guidance, citing the downturn in the global economy.</p><p>Western Digital Corp., up 22 cents at $12.72</p><p>The hard drive maker said it plans to cut about 5 percent of its work force in response to weakening demand for its products.</p><p>Aetna Inc., down 38 cents at $24.42</p><p>The managed-care company will cut 1,000 jobs, or nearly 3 percent of its staff, to reduce costs and adjust to the slow economy.</p><p>NASDAQ</p><p>Apple Inc., down $6.27 at $89.16</p><p>The computer icon's CEO, Steve Jobs, won't attend January's Macworld tradeshow, the company's last appearance at the event.</p><img src="http://admatch-syndication.mochila.com/images/ad.gif?aid=38868595&bid=informcom" /></div><div id="copyright"><div>
